THE season reached a thrilling climax at Wigginton Bowls Club’s championship finals day.
The season finale featured some excellent bowling and a series of tight matches, three of which were decided either on the final end or extra ends.
Jane Stockton won the ladies’ singles title for the fourth consecutive year after a 21-7 victory over Norma Davies.
Stockton then teamed up with Sheila Grimes to win the ladies’ pairs, beating Madge Cooper and Jean Millar 23-21 after an extra end.
The men’s singles was won by John Freeman, a 21-17 victory over Dave Jervis.
Michael Wadsworth claimed the veterans’ singles crown, with a 21-14 victory over Brian Hutton, while the vets’ pairs trophy went to David Moorhouse and Madge Cooper, who edged out Dave Jervis and Michael Grimes 14-13.
Jervis enjoyed better fortune in the final of the men’s pairs as he and Simon Ewing stormed to a 29-10 victory over Brian Hutton and Bill Tomlinson.
In the final of the open pairs, Marjorie Watson and John Parsons were 21-18 winners over Brian Hutton and Ken Magson.
Norma Davies, Doreen Wadsworth and Simon Ewing needed an extra end to win the open triples, beating Jane Stockton, Michael Grimes and Gary Stockton 18-15.
The trophies were presented by president Michael Haseltine, chairman Jean Millar and captain Michael Barlow.
